Packing Essentials: Workout Gear for Travel
Packing the right workout gear is crucial for staying fit on the road. You want to ensure that you have everything you need without overloading your suitcase. Start by selecting versatile clothing that can be mixed and matched easily.
Lightweight, moisture-wicking fabrics are ideal for workouts, as they keep you comfortable during exercise and dry quickly after washing. Don’t forget to include a good pair of running shoes; they are essential for any fitness routine and can double as casual footwear during your travels. In addition to clothing, consider packing portable workout equipment such as resistance bands or a jump rope.
These items are lightweight and can easily fit into your luggage, allowing you to perform a variety of exercises no matter where you are. If you have space, a yoga mat can also be beneficial for stretching or practicing yoga in your hotel room or at a nearby park. By being strategic about what you pack, you can ensure that you’re prepared to stay active no matter where your travels take you.

Eating Well: Maintaining a Healthy Diet While Traveling
Maintaining a healthy diet while traveling can be one of the most challenging aspects of staying fit on the road. With tempting local cuisines and convenience foods readily available, it’s easy to stray from your nutritional goals. However, with some mindful planning and choices, you can enjoy delicious meals without compromising your health.
Start by researching local restaurants that offer healthy options or farm-to-table dining experiences. When possible, opt for accommodations with kitchen facilities so you can prepare some of your meals. This not only allows you to control what goes into your food but also gives you the chance to experiment with local ingredients.
If cooking isn’t an option, look for grocery stores or markets where you can purchase fresh fruits and vegetables for snacks or light meals. By being proactive about your food choices, you can maintain a balanced diet while still indulging in the culinary delights of your destination.

What are some exercises that can be done in a hotel room?
– Bodyweight exercises like squats, lunges, push-ups, and planks require minimal space and no equipment.
– High-intensity interval training (HIIT) workouts can be done in a small area and provide a quick, effective workout.
– Yoga and stretching routines can help maintain flexibility and reduce stiffness from travel.
